Now we all know there’s more to life than Stock Car Racing. I just so happen to be a Wrasslin Fan. Saturday after the Xfinity Race something happened. It was a PPV held in Toronto, Canada called: Elimination Chamber.

In the Main Event segment of the evening. John Cena has been a “Babyface” (Good Guy) since his debut in 2002, and he did the unthinkable: He turned “Heel” (Bad Guy) and WWE is about to make monumental business based on that fact alone. We’re talking Wrestlemania 3 and Andre vs Hogan value in my dumb opinion.

The Point is Sports (and Entertainment) are better off with Babyfaces and Heels. Even in a Sponsor Draw Environment. So why isn’t NASCAR branding a bad boy lineup of Carson Hocevar, Ross Chastain, Austin Dillon, Kyle Busch, etc?? If you give us heels to boo against we’ll make Baby Faces to cheer for That Noah Gragson has charisma that’s for sure. I’m sure you’ll want us to boo on Denny Hamlin. Good Luck with that. You give the TV audience something to root for, You give the Fanbase something to hold within their hearts, and especially: You have the potential to draw more money!
